Transaction 84bb79256d2d91801e54eac506a3970a1586e6e61406db51c92d41f92f4d6bec
1 Input
1 Output
-
84bb79256d2d91801e54eac506a3970a1586e6e61406db51c92d41f92f4d6bec:0
- value
- 1073522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adf15336b5fce7806b3dda763322e58498c4c87d OP_EQUAL
- address
- 3HYjvHimJ3gutbQBpZ8Nc7UqWhjgB7LGEj